Sergio Barbosa Serra (June 2009)

Where: Bonn 2009: 30th SBSTA & SBI; 6th AWG LCA & 8th AWG LCA

Sergio Barbosa Serra, Brazil’s Ambassador and Special Representative for Climate Change Negotiations, discusses the state of negotiations in the Long-term Cooperative Action and Kyoto Protocol tracks, talks about the importance of forestry in Brazil, and explains why the participants in the process are waiting on new legislation from the US.
